Slides.InsertFromFile method (PowerPoint)
Inserts slides from a file into a presentation, at the specified location. Returns an Integer that represents the number of slides inserted.
Syntax
expression. InsertFromFile
( _FileName_
, _Index_
, _SlideStart_
, _SlideEnd_
)
expression A variable that represents a Slides object.
Parameters
Name | Required/Optional | Data type | Description |
---|---|---|---|
FileName | Required | String | The name of the file that contains the slides you want to insert. |
Index | Required | Long | The index number of the Slide object in the specified Slides collection you want to insert the new slides after. |
SlideStart | Optional | Long | The index number of the first Slide object in the Slides collection in the file denoted by FileName. |
SlideEnd | Optional | Long | The index number of the last Slide object in the Slides collection in the file denoted by FileName. |
Return value
Integer
Example
This example inserts slides three through six from C:\Ppt\Sales.ppt after slide two in the active presentation.
ActivePresentation.Slides.InsertFromFile _
"c:\ppt\sales.ppt", 2, 3, 6
